4 connections·7 entities in this video→Capturing Screenshots with Physical Buttons
- 📸 To take a screenshot on the Samsung Galaxy Tab S11 5G, simultaneously press the volume down and power buttons.
- ⚡ A brief flash and a popup with options like edit, tag, share, and Google Lens will appear, then disappear automatically.
Locating and Managing Screenshots
- 🖼️ Screenshots are saved in the Gallery app, typically appearing at the top under 'Pictures' immediately after capture.
- 🗂️ For easier access later, navigate to the 'Albums' section in the Gallery, where a dedicated 'Screenshot' album will store all captured images.
Exploring Alternate and AI Screenshot Features
- 💡 The tablet offers alternative screenshot methods, including an option to select and crop a specific area of the screen.
- 🤖 While marketed as 'AI Select,' the functionality for cropping specific areas is described as similar to previous non-AI methods.
- ⚠️ The AI screenshot features require an internet connection and a signed-in Samsung account to function.
- ⚙️ The AI selection process involves a distinctive animation, similar to 'Circle to Search,' but it is not actively functional in this context.
- 💾 Once an area is selected for cropping, you must save the selection by clicking the designated button.
